Stepping in Style: The Timeless Appeal of Brogue Shoes

Brogue shoes have been a popular footwear choice for both men and women for centuries. These shoes are known for their distinctive decorative perforations, or “broguing,” that adorn the leather upper. Originally designed as practical shoes for outdoor wear in Scotland and Ireland, brogues have since become a stylish and versatile option for any occasion.

The history of brogue shoes can be traced back to the early 20th century when they were worn by Scottish and Irish farmers who needed sturdy footwear to work in muddy fields. The perforations on the shoe’s upper allowed water to drain out quickly, keeping the feet dry and comfortable. Over time, brogues became popular among wealthy gentlemen in England who wore them as a fashionable alternative to boots.

Today, brogue shoes come in a variety of styles, from classic wingtips with intricate perforations to more modern designs with subtle detailing. They are available in a range of colors and materials, including leather, suede, and even canvas.

One of the great things about brogue shoes is their versatility. They can be dressed up or down depending on the occasion. For example, a pair of brown leather brogues can be worn with jeans and a sweater for a casual look or paired with dress pants and a blazer for a more formal event.

Brogue shoes are also comfortable to wear thanks to their sturdy construction and supportive sole. They provide good arch support and cushioning for the feet, making them an excellent choice for those who spend long hours on their feet.

Finally, it’s worth noting that brogue shoes are durable and long-lasting. With proper care and maintenance, they can last for many years without losing their style or comfort.

What styles of brogues are available?

There are several styles of brogues available, each with its own unique design and level of formality. Here are some of the most common styles of brogue shoes:

  1. Full Brogue: Also known as wingtips, these shoes have a distinctive “W” shape on the toe cap and decorative perforations along the edges of the shoe. They are considered to be the most formal style of brogue and are often worn with suits.
  2. Semi-Brogue: These shoes have a similar design to full brogues but with fewer decorative perforations. They are slightly less formal than full brogues but can still be worn with dress pants and blazers.
  3. Quarter Brogue: These shoes have a simple toe cap design with only a few decorative perforations along the edges. They are less formal than full or semi-brogues and can be worn with casual or business-casual attire.
  4. Longwing Brogue: These shoes have a distinctive wingtip that extends all the way to the heel, creating a continuous line along the shoe’s edge. They are typically more casual than other styles of brogues and can be worn with jeans or chinos.
  5. Ghillie Brogue: These shoes are traditionally worn as part of Scottish Highland dress and feature long laces that wrap around the ankle and tie in front. They have a distinctive open lacing system and decorative perforations along the edges.

In addition to these styles, there are also variations in color, material, and detailing that can make each pair of brogues unique. From classic brown leather to modern suede or canvas, there is sure to be a style of brogue that fits your personal taste and needs.

How should I care for my brogue shoes?

Proper care and maintenance can help your brogue shoes last for many years while keeping them looking great. Here are some tips on how to care for your brogues:

  1. Clean regularly: Dirt and dust can accumulate on the surface of your shoes, so it’s important to clean them regularly. Use a soft-bristled brush or cloth to remove any dirt or debris from the surface of the leather.
  2. Condition the leather: Leather can dry out over time, leading to cracks and other damage. To prevent this, use a leather conditioner to keep the leather supple and moisturized.
  3. Polish the shoes: Polishing your brogue shoes can help protect the leather and give it a nice shine. Use a high-quality shoe polish that matches the color of your shoes.
  4. Store properly: When you’re not wearing your brogues, store them in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Avoid storing them in plastic bags or other containers that don’t allow air circulation.
  5. Use shoe trees: Shoe trees are wooden inserts that help maintain the shape of your shoes while they’re being stored. They also absorb any moisture and odors inside the shoes.
  6. Rotate your shoes: Wearing the same pair of shoes every day can cause them to wear out more quickly. To extend their lifespan, rotate between different pairs of shoes so that each pair gets a chance to rest.

By following these simple tips, you can keep your brogue shoes looking great for years to come!

How do I know what size to buy for my brogues?

When buying brogues or any other type of shoes, it’s important to get the right size to ensure comfort and prevent foot problems. Here are some tips on how to determine your correct size for brogues:

  1. Measure your feet: Use a ruler or measuring tape to measure the length of your foot from the heel to the longest toe. Do this for both feet as they may be slightly different sizes.
  2. Check a sizing chart: Most shoe brands provide sizing charts that match foot measurements with corresponding shoe sizes. Check the brand’s website or ask a salesperson for help.
  3. Consider width: Shoe sizes not only vary in length but also in width, so it’s important to consider this when choosing a size. If you have wide feet, look for shoes that come in wider widths.
  4. Try them on: The best way to determine if a shoe fits well is to try it on and walk around in it. Make sure there is enough room in the toe box and that the heel is snug but not too tight.
  5. Shop at the end of the day: Feet tend to swell throughout the day, so it’s best to shop for shoes at the end of the day when your feet are at their largest.
  6. Don’t be afraid to ask for help: If you’re unsure about what size or width to choose, don’t hesitate to ask a salesperson for assistance.

By following these tips, you should be able to find the right size brogues that fit comfortably and look great on you.
